Strawberry Yogurt Shakes Recipe
  • Prep/Total Time: 10 min.
  • Yield: 6 Servings
10 10

Ingredients

  • 2 cups (16 ounces) plain yogurt
  • 1 cup milk
  • 1/2 cup honey
  • 1-1/2 cups frozen unsweetened strawberries
  • 1/4 cup toasted wheat germ
  • 1/4 teaspoon almond extract
  • Dash salt

Directions

  • In two batches, process all ingredients in a blender until smooth. Pour into chilled glasses; serve immediately. Yield: 6 servings.

Nutritional Facts 1 serving (1 cup) equals 187 calories, 4 g fat (3 g saturated fat), 15 mg cholesterol, 81 mg sodium, 34 g carbohydrate, 1 g fiber, 6 g protein.
